Myth 1: Fleet Leasing Always Costs More Than Buying

Buying a fleet outright can seem like a good financial move for many businesses. However, this ignores many of the factors that you need to take into account with fleet management, including vehicle life cycles and acquisition costs. With leasing, you’ll be able to spread your costs over a longer period rather than pay a lump sum upfront. Additionally, with fleet leasing, expenses like fleet maintenance and repairs are included in the contract, meaning that you won’t have to worry about budgeting separately for these expenses.

Myth 2: Leased Vehicles Are Always Low-Quality

This is perhaps the most outdated and untrue of the common myths surrounding fleet leasing. In reality, leased vehicles can be as high-end as the manufacturer and dealer offer, and more often than not, you’ll be able to access state-of-the-art vehicles, customized to your specific industry. Myth 3: You’ll Be Locked into a Long-Term Contract

This isn’t entirely true. While there are certain lease terms you must abide by, vehicle lease agreements are fluid and can be altered to adapt to your changing business needs. For example, if your business shifts course and you need more or fewer vehicles, it’s possible to rework your lease agreements.
